Conviction of a murderer. Boston, Dec. 8.
--James Hurley, who killed William Loughrey, while the latter was arresting him for a burglary, committed some months since, was to-day found guilty of murder in the second degree.
At the close of the ceremony, Chief Justice Bigelow ruled that if the jury find that the purpose of killing was first entertained by the prisoner during the struggle with Loughrey, they cannot find him guilty of murder in the first degree under the statute, even although they also find that Harley know Loughrey to be an officer and was looking to arrest him. Hurley is quite young but known as a desperate thief and burglar.

Rates of discount on Bank notes at New York. New York, Dec. 8th.
--The rates of discount uncurrent money are advancing, under the influence of the heavy depreciation of State stocks.
Illinois, Wisconsin, Iowa and Missouri paper is at 12 to 15 per cent, discount; Pennsylvania and Maryland 1 to 5 per cent., and Ohio and Kentucky 3 per cent.
Tennessee. Nashville, Dec. 8.
--The Governor of this Sale has called an extra session of the Legislature on the 7th of January, to consider the present condition of the country.

Departure of the Arago. New York, Dec. 8.
--The steamship Arago sailed Havre and Southampton, at noon, to-day, with seventy passengers and $25,400 in specie.
